A fire of yet-unknown origin destroyed the former shops building of the New York, Ontario & Western Railway in Middletown, Orange County, N.Y. on Nov. 19th.

The Middletown Fire Department reported a call came in at 11:23 local time for the fire at the complex along Midland Ave. in Middletown. The large fire sent sparks and embers soaring, which set off a few brush fires in the area behind the building, according to authorities. News updates indicates the structures were a total loss.

The shops were abandoned in 1957 along with the entire railroad in 1957; since then the building had been adapted for other uses, including a movie production soundstage, warehouse, and more recently an Amazon warehouse.

The shops were not the only NYO&W structure in town to be fire-damaged. As described in a thread here years ago, the former NYO&W station and company headquarters building downtown was damaged by fire in Feb. 2004; formerly a nightclub, it survives partially used as a restaurant supply warehouse today. Elsewhere in town, a wooden 1871 depot survives on the Middletown & New Jersey trackage, and the former Erie 1897 stone and brick passenger station is now part of the much expanded town library.
